Here, we present UCASpatial, an ultra-resolution cellular spectrum decomposition algorithm in spatial transcriptomics based on an entropy-weighted regression model for uncovering spatiotemporal transition and multicellular communities among cell subpopulations. UCASpatial demonstrates high sensitivity and accuracy in discriminating cell subpopulations with low proportion and subtle transcriptomic differences in ST, enabling precise resolution of cellular spectrum unbiasedly. |
